Norman Noble, a global leader in the contract manufacturing of advanced medical implants and devices, announces the successful renewal of its Quality Management System (QMS) certification to the ISO 13485:2016 standard. This milestone comes after an extensive and thorough audit conducted by the British Standards Institute (BSI), a prestigious European Union Notified Body.
ISO 13485:2016 is an internationally esteemed quality standard specifically designed for the medical device sector. By securing this recertification, Norman Noble reaffirms its steadfast commitment to upholding the highest standards of product quality and regulatory compliance in the medical device industry. The company has maintained ISO 13485 certification since 2004, consistently demonstrating a proactive approach to meeting evolving regulatory requirements on both domestic and global fronts, including those set by the FDA, European MDR, and Brazil ANVISA.
This achievement not only fortifies Norman Noble’s reputation as a trusted partner in the medical device manufacturing industry but also provides crucial support to its customers in navigating the complex regulatory landscape.
